Course summary

UWE Bristol's MA Fine Art: Photography builds on our celebrated reputation for postgraduate study in photography. Designed to develop your creative promise, this course is ideal if you want to push the potential of your own fine art photography practice.

Why study this course?

You will study our innovative curriculum alongside a purposefully small group of peers, uniquely designed to offer critical, collaborative and personal approaches to photography in contemporary cultural contexts. A combined focus on personal work, professional practice, and critical research will maximise your creative outputs, and contextualise photography as an artistic discipline.

You will gain knowledge and insights into contemporary arts practice and debates, taught by a diverse team of award-winning photographers and leading academics in the field.

Where can it take me?

You will graduate with a globally recognised qualification and have a broad range of options available to you regionally, as well as nationally and internationally. The course offers you the opportunity to develop your photography practice, and many of our graduates have continued into award-winning careers in the field. Others pursue a career in galleries and museums, in film, education, or the wider creative industries. You may also wish to consider a PhD pathway within one of our excellent research centres.
